在当今数字化时代,服务器数据库作为企业信息存储和管理的核心,其稳定性和可靠性至关重要,在实际运营中,我们可能会遇到服务器数据库查不出数据的问题,这无疑给企业带来了极大的困扰,本文将深入探讨这一问题,从原因分析到解决方案,旨在帮助读者更好地理解和应对此类问题。

服务器数据库查不出数据的原因分析
-
数据库配置错误
- 数据库配置文件错误,如连接字符串错误、端口配置错误等。
- 数据库驱动程序版本不兼容。
-
网络问题
- 服务器与数据库之间的网络连接不稳定或中断。
- 网络防火墙设置导致数据库访问被阻止。
-
数据库性能问题
- 数据库服务器资源不足,如CPU、内存、磁盘空间等。
- 数据库索引失效或缺失,导致查询效率低下。
-
数据库损坏

- 数据库文件损坏,如MDF/LDF文件损坏。
- 数据库备份文件损坏或丢失。
-
应用程序问题
- 应用程序代码错误,如SQL语句错误、参数传递错误等。
- 应用程序与数据库版本不兼容。
解决方案与优化措施
数据库配置检查
- 检查数据库配置文件,确保连接字符串、端口等配置正确。
- 更新数据库驱动程序至最新版本。
网络问题排查
- 检查服务器与数据库之间的网络连接,确保网络稳定。
- 配置网络防火墙,允许数据库访问。
数据库性能优化
- 监控数据库服务器资源使用情况,确保资源充足。
- 优化数据库索引,提高查询效率。
数据库文件修复与备份
- 使用数据库修复工具修复损坏的数据库文件。
- 定期备份数据库,以防数据丢失。
应用程序代码审查
- 仔细检查应用程序代码,修复SQL语句错误和参数传递错误。
- 确保应用程序与数据库版本兼容。
经验案例分享
以下是一个结合酷盾(kd.cn)自身云产品的经验案例:
案例背景:某企业使用酷盾云数据库服务,近期出现数据库查不出数据的问题。
解决方案:

- 首先通过酷盾云数据库监控工具发现,数据库服务器CPU使用率过高。
- 分析原因后,发现是由于大量并发查询导致。
- 通过调整数据库配置,优化查询语句,并增加服务器资源,问题得到解决。
FAQs
问题1:如何预防数据库查不出数据的问题?
解答:定期检查数据库配置、网络连接、服务器资源,优化数据库索引,加强应用程序代码审查,并定期备份数据库。
问题2:数据库查不出数据时,应该采取哪些紧急措施?
解答:首先检查网络连接和数据库配置,然后尝试修复数据库文件,最后联系专业技术人员进行诊断和修复。
文献权威来源
《数据库系统原理与应用》,作者:张宇翔,出版社:清华大学出版社。
《网络数据库技术》,作者:李晓东,出版社:人民邮电出版社。
原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/426978.html